(IDEX Online) - A jeweler had his uninsured suitcase of diamonds and jewelry, valued at over $1m, stolen as he packed up at the end of a gem show in Houston, Texas, USA.

"It takes so much to collect... and to see everything vanish... It's your entire life savings. It's gone," Iftikhar Sayed, 72, told local news channel Click2Houston.

He and his wife had been displaying their goods at the International Gem & Jewelry Show in Houston, at the NRG Center (pictured).

They'd packed up, Mr Sayed went to get his car, and when he returned he found the suitcase containing his entire inventory, together with his jacket and wallet, had been stolen.

Mr Sayed, who opened Sayed Creations in 1982, was not insured.  CCTV shows the thief walking out the front door and driving off with the stolen goods.  Houston Police Department is investigating....
